Role-playing enthusiasts can look forward to Esoteric Ebb, a satirical CRPG from publisher Raw Fury, known for the Kingdom series. Designed for those who appreciate unconventional storylines, Esoteric Ebb centers on The Cleric, an atypical character navigating a turbulent political environment. The game’s hand-drawn, isometric visuals and blend of humor and intrigue promise a departure from traditional hero-centered quests, instead favoring flawed, relatable protagonists who fall short of heroic ideals in unexpected ways.

What Sets Esoteric Ebb Apart from Other RPGs?
Esoteric Ebb introduces players to a world where the focus lies not on perfect heroism, but on embracing mistakes and navigating the consequences. The story follows The Cleric, who becomes embroiled in a conspiracy during the region’s first-ever election. Interactions with unconventional characters such as devil barristers and goblin queens underscore the game’s offbeat flavor, giving players agency to influence events in either serious or comedic ways.
How Does the Game Address Past RPG Tropes?
By satirizing traditions like the powerful, infallible cleric—common in Dungeons & Dragons—Esoteric Ebb highlights the pressures and errors associated with high-responsibility roles. The gameplay is designed to encourage failure and unpredictable narrative twists. Raw Fury notes,
“Esoteric Ebb is about the ever-switching favor of the gods, and how a single poor dice roll can upend the cleric’s destiny,”
inviting players to take risks without fear of permanent punishment. The player’s actions, and even mistakes, become central to the unfolding story, reflecting the uncertainty of both politics and role-playing adventures.
What Can Players Expect from the Launch and Demo?
A playable demo is now available on Steam, allowing players to experience the game’s distinctive humor and story-driven mechanics ahead of its launch. The full release is planned for spring 2026, giving the developers ample time to refine narrative elements and interactive features.
